Too Hot to Handle 1960

A French journalist sent to expose the secret strip clubs of London’s Soho becomes entangled in the personal lives of the venue’s charismatic owner and its dazzling star performer. As she digs deeper, the film reveals the seductive, dangerous underworld of the city’s hidden nightlife, blending intrigue, ambition and sensuality.

Does Too Hot to Handle have end credit scenes?

No!

Too Hot to Handle does not have end credit scenes. You can leave when the credits roll.
